The Analysis
Home Brew is a warm, golden beige that acts as a reliable neutral, effectively brightening rooms that lack natural sunlight. With an LRV of 61, it reflects a significant amount of light, which helps smaller spaces feel open and less cramped.
This shade serves best as a versatile main wall color that anchors a room without dictating the entire decor scheme. It is subtle enough to let furniture and art take center stage while providing a warm, finished backdrop.

It leans into a classic, timeless aesthetic that draws inspiration from traditional Craftsman and farmhouse interiors. It avoids being trendy, offering a reliable look that has felt relevant in residential design for decades.
How to Use It
It pairs beautifully with warm wood tones like oak or walnut and contrasts sharply against matte black hardware for a modern edge. It works exceptionally well in kitchens or living areas where you want to emphasize a cozy, welcoming environment.
The Mood
This color provides an energizing and optimistic atmosphere without being overwhelming. It feels grounded and approachable, making it a stable, comfortable choice for high-traffic areas of the home.
Colour harmonies
Complementary
Opposite on the colour wheel — bold, high-contrast pairings. Use for a feature wall or furniture you want to command attention.
Analogous
Neighbouring hues — cohesive and calm, great for layered schemes that feel collected rather than matched.
Split complementary
Near-opposites for strong contrast with a little less tension than a pure complement. A favourite of interior designers.
Triadic
Three evenly spaced hues — balanced, vibrant, and versatile. Keep one dominant and use the others sparingly.
Tetradic (square)
Four hues in a square on the wheel — rich, dynamic palettes. Best when one colour leads and the others accent.
Monochromatic
Dark, mid, and light steps on the same hue — a failsafe gradient for trim, walls, and accents without shifting colour family.
